The craftsmanship of handmade couches begins with selecting timber for the frame. Artisans typically choose hardwoods such as oak, maple, or cherry, which are known for their sturdiness. The cushions are often filled with natural products like down or wool, offering convenience that mass-produced couches rarely match. Each piece take advantage of the practitioner's skills, enabling unique touches in design and detailing.
Popular Styles of Handmade Couches
The world of classic handmade couches offers a range of styles, each providing its appeal and elegance. Here are some popular choices:
Chesterfield: A classic British design defined by its deep button-tufting and rolled arms, the Chesterfield is associated with beauty and tradition.
Mid-Century Modern: Featuring tidy lines and a minimalist aesthetic, mid-century modern couches are a preferred for those who value simpleness and performance.
Sectionals: Custom-built sectionals use substantial choices in layout and fabric, making them adaptable for various areas and events.
Scroll Arm Sofas: With their elegantly curved arms and luxurious cushions, scroll arm sofas blend convenience with classic design.
Sofas: These smaller sized couches are ideal for entranceways or bed rooms and are frequently decorated with sophisticated materials and patterns.

Often Asked Questions (FAQs)What is the typical expense of a handmade couch?
The price of a handmade couch can vary substantially based on materials, size, and workmanship. Normally, rates can vary from ₤ 1,500 to over ₤ 5,000.
For how long does it take to make a handmade couch?
Creating a handmade couch can take anywhere from 6 weeks to numerous months, depending on the intricacy of the style and the workload of the craftsmen.
